Introduction to R for Machine Learning: Data Structures, Tidyverse, and Data Wrangling is a comprehensive guide for beginners and intermediate learners who want to master R for data science and machine learning applications. This book begins with a clear introduction to R programming, exploring fundamental data structures such as vectors, matrices, lists, and data frames. It then delves into the Tidyverse, the powerful collection of R packages designed for efficient data manipulation, visualization, and analysis. Readers will gain hands-on experience in data wrangling, learning how to clean, transform, and prepare datasets for machine learning models. Through practical examples, exercises, and real-world datasets, this book equips readers with the essential skills to confidently handle and analyze data in R, laying a strong foundation for advanced machine learning techniques. Whether you are a student, analyst, or aspiring data scientist, this book bridges the gap between theoretical concepts and practical applications, making R an accessible and powerful tool for your data-driven projects.
